Description

Plex organizes all of your video, music, TV, and photo collections, and streams them to all of your screens. With the free Plex Media Server on your home computer and Plex for iOS, you can watch and listen to all of your personal media on your iOS device and share it with friends and family. Enjoy unlimited use of free features of this app, and unlock its full functionality with a Plex Pass subscription -OR- a small one-time in-app purchase (see below).

Here are some ways that Plex makes your media experience awesome:
• Makes your media beautiful with artwork, descriptions, and more
• Automatically converts your media on-the-fly to play on any device
• Makes sharing your media with friends and family simple and easy
• Lets you browse, fling, and control your media on most Plex apps
• Gives you access to a wide range of online channels such as TED Talks, Revision3, and TWiT
• Enables you to queue online videos from sites like Vimeo and YouTube and then Watch Later on any device

FREE FUNCTIONALITY:
• Unlimited casting of photos and videos from the Camera Roll on your phone or tablet to all of your screens (such as your computer, smartphone, tablet, streaming devices, game consoles, smart TVs, and more!)
• Unlimited casting of any media on your Plex Media Server to all of your screens
• Remote control of your big screen Plex Apps

LIMITATION: Playing media from your Plex Media Server on the device running this app is limited (one minute for music and video, watermark on photos) until the app is unlocked

UNLOCK FULL FUNCTIONALITY:
You can remove the playback limitations on the app in several ways:
• Use a Plex Pass enabled account to sign into the app -OR-
• Sign up for a monthly Plex Pass subscription in the iOS app -OR-
• Make a small, one-time, in-app purchase of just the iOS app itself

NOTE: If you've already purchased the app or have a Plex Pass, you do NOT need to purchase again!

Customer Reviews

Excellent server and apps

Plex is the best server and player we have found. It just works and it works very well! Over local net, offsite wifi, or cellular it works wonderfully. The ability to specify bit rate to save on cell data transfer is absolutely wonderful - this is a huge plus for Me with Plex. An annoyance is that I have found the PS3 application doesn't readily manage ACC 5.1 sound correctly; I have tried settings on the PS3, but still have issues. Removing links to files that have themselves been removed from the server seems to be improved. A suggestion for the live transcoder would be to come up with a way to manage jittery video files with an image tracking/smoothing algorithm; this would be way above and beyond, but there are times when encoders don't resolve the video images as smoothly as they could even with the right frame rates and high bit rates. BUT, I do have to say that nothing comes close to Plex!!! I am a lifetime Plexpass holder and was glad to pay the cost; the Apple TV app is great - no issues with AAC 5.1 sound on that app or device whatsoever, and the overall service is wonderful. As a user of a 9.1 system, it would be nice if the plex technology could use the current bluray 7.1 sound capabilities through the service, but I realize a lot of "stuff" likely needs to catch up for that to happen.

OK but frustratingly lacks basic features

This is, so far, the best app I’ve found for streaming media from my NAS, having seen that last day or so trying various applications. However, there are a few glaring, obvious, functionality issues.

In music there is no gapless playback. This makes listening to live recordings or classical a poor experience. The filtering in Music is also fairly useless. For example, when viewing by artists, the only filters are genre, country, collection. you cannot filter by artists, which wouldn’t be a big deal if the index on the right side worked, which is doesn’t. It works on the iPad, sometimes, but not on my 5s. I suspect it’s too far into the margin on the right and it just doesn’t work. Maybe it works on the 6+. When you have 500+ artists this is a problem.

My primary use is for streaming music from my NAS, and I cannot recommend this app for that.
